Understanding Executive Education Opportunities in Scandinavia
Scandinavia, encompassing countries like Sweden, Denmark, and Norway, is renowned for its high standards in education, innovation, and corporate governance. Multinational corporations based in this region often champion executive education, recognizing its role in fostering future leaders. Scholarships targeting executives are designed to attract top talent, offering immersive learning experiences in areas such as sustainable business, digital transformation, and global management. For professionals in Kenya, these programs provide a unique chance to gain insights into Scandinavian business models, which often prioritize social responsibility and environmental stewardship. The competitive nature of these scholarships means a strong application highlighting leadership potential and a clear vision for applying learned skills back in Kenya is essential.

Navigating Scholarship Costs and Investment
While scholarships aim to cover educational expenses, understanding the full investment is crucial for executives in Kenya. Scholarship coverage can vary widely, from tuition fees to living stipends and travel allowances. Some programs might require a co-payment or have associated costs not directly covered, potentially ranging from KES 500,000 to KES 2,000,000 or more, depending on the program's duration and scope. It is vital to thoroughly review the scholarship details to ascertain what is included. For Kenyan executives, securing additional funding or employer sponsorship might be necessary. This investment, however, often yields substantial returns through enhanced skills, expanded networks, and improved organizational performance.
